+Adding Icons
+------------
+
+Icons that are meant to someday be themeable MUST be for one or more
+of the following sizes:
+
+- 16x16
+- 18x18
+- 20x20
+- 24x24
+- 32x32
+- 48x48
+
+(the following sizes may also be added for use with window
+decorations: 64x64 and 128x128)
+
+All icons should be named consistantly and be placed within the proper
+subdir that corresponds to their size (if the subdir does not yet
+exist, because no icons have been made for that size - then create the
+subdir and add it to the build as well).
+
+If it is expected that the icon(s) you've created will make it into
+the GNOME icon themes package at some point (or is already there?),
+then you will want to name your icons accordingly so that if the user
+installs a GNOME icons theme package with the appropriate icon(s),
+then he or she will see those icons rather than the ones installed by
+default with Evolution.
+
+The icons within the WWxHH subdirs will ONLY be used if they cnnot be
+found in the theme.
+
+The ONLY image files that may be placed in the toplevel art/ srcdir
+(eg. *this* dir) are xpm files that are built into the Evolution binary
+(or libs) and/or are not meant to be used as "icons".
